A pregnancy ultrasound is an imaging examination that uses sound waves to develop a picture of how a child is creating in the womb. It is additionally made use of to inspect the female pelvic body organs while pregnant. Pregnancy sonogram; Obstetric ultrasonography; Obstetric sonogram; Ultrasound - maternity; IUGR - ultrasound; Intrauterine development - ultrasound; Polyhydramnios - ultrasound; Oligohydramnios - ultrasound; Placenta previa - ultrasound; Multiple pregnancy - ultrasound; Genital bleeding while pregnant - ultrasound; Fetal surveillance - ultrasound To have the procedure: You will rest on your back on an exam table.


A handheld probe will certainly after that be relocated over the area. The gel helps the probe transmit sound waves. These waves jump off the body structures, consisting of the creating baby, to produce a photo on the ultrasound equipment. In many cases, a maternity ultrasound might be done by placing the probe into the vaginal area.

You will require to have a complete bladder to get the ideal ultrasound picture. You may be asked to consume 2 to 3 glasses of fluid an hour before the test. DO NOT pee before the treatment. There might be some discomfort from pressure on the complete bladder. The performing gel might feel a little cool and damp.


Search for doubles or triplets. Take a look at the placenta, amniotic fluid, and hips. Some facilities are currently executing a maternity ultrasound called a nuchal clarity testing examination around 9 to 13 weeks of pregnancy. This examination is done to seek signs of Down disorder or other troubles in the establishing child.

An ultrasound likewise called a sonogram aids your physician learn whether the unborn child is establishing typically. Your physician could advise that you have 1 or even more ultrasounds at different points in your maternity. It can be made use of to check the composition of the fetus for defects or troubles. Depending on exactly how much along your maternity is, ultrasound pictures assist your physician: estimate your due day check points like the dimension and position of the unborn child to make certain whatever is typical see the position of the placenta see the amount of amniotic liquid in your womb discover multiple maternities (doubles, triplets, etc) Ultrasounds can likewise be made use of to evaluate for certain abnormality, like Down disorder.


Physicians, midwives, or trained ultrasound technicians will do your ultrasound and read the results. The price of an ultrasound depends on the kind of ultrasound you get and where you obtain it.

Ultrasound scans use sound waves to develop an image of your baby on a television display. The scans are risk-free and can be lugged out at any type of stage of your maternity. A lot of ultrasounds are 'transabdominal ultrasounds'. This suggests that the ultrasound probe is rubbed carefully on your stomach (abdominal area) to create a photo of the child on the display.


You will certainly be brought right into a dark area. fetal doppler. The darkness makes it less complicated for the individual doing the check to clearly see the picture on the screen. You will be asked to push a sofa and raise up your top to reveal your stomach. You might need to roll down the waist of your trousers.
